Understanding UK Solar Panel Grants
& Why They Work

16 April 2024 | Grants & Schemes

The UK has seen a steady increase in the adoption of solar panels, with 1.5 million installations occupying the rooftops of just under 2% of homes in the nation. Despite solar energy accounting for only 6.8% of the electricity generated in the last quarter of 2023, the drive towards sustainable energy has never been stronger.

What are Solar Panels and How Do They Work?


Solar panels are roof-mounted devices that essentially convert sunlight into electricity. They are made up of photovoltaic (PV) cells that absorb sunlight and transform it into power, supplied for your home. Operating all year round, solar panels are designed to collect and store energy efficiently, ready for use in your household’s heating, lighting, and tech. This technology stands out for its ability to harness an unlimited natural resource; the sun.

Energy Saving Benefits


Clean Power – They harness unlimited solar energy, reducing dependency on traditional power sources.

Operational Efficiency – Even during overcast days, solar panels can collect solar energy to power homes.

Environmental Impact – By relying on renewable energy, they significantly lower carbon emissions.

Money Saving Benefits


Reduced Bills – Solar panels decrease reliance on energy suppliers, reducing costs associated with running your home.

Increased Property Value – Homes equipped with solar panels are modern upgrades, increasing the appeal and value of your property.

Low Maintenance – Once installed, solar panels require minimal upkeep, ensuring cost-effectiveness over time.

Solar Panel Grants in the UK


The UK government has stepped up to support more households in making the transition to solar. The ECO4 grant scheme currently leads the charge in offering solar panel grants. Aimed primarily at assisting low-income and vulnerable households, this scheme facilitates the integration of solar panels alongside other energy-saving measures, adopting a ‘whole house’ retrofit approach.
